What's the average weight and displacement of the MINI's you're used to?

 

Reason I ask, is that I believe the Z will have much more displacement for the weight of the vehicle, meaning that it's going to feel much more "torquey". This is something I didn't really think about much until recently but I can go back through the history of all the cars I've driven and can definitely make the correlation in the numbers.

 

A 1.8 liter CRX can actually "feel" like it's got more torque, or "power off idle", than a 4.7 liter toyota tundra.

 

I can also say it this way. Torque is nearly meaningless without context. Torque more than anything is an indicator and should be used as such. A diesel isn't powerful off idle because it makes a crap ton of torque, it's actually because it makes so much bloody HP off idle. HP moves cars, not torque. HP puts you in your seat, not torque.

 

But if I say an engine has 400lbs of torque off idle (we'll assume 1k rpm) that's over 75HP, which is a boatload when it's that low in RPM. It's going to get an object MOVING.

 

The this is though, is that torque is directly tied to displacement in NA applications. So for comparing NA vehicles to NA vehicles, we can use displacement to weight to directly compare how they'll drive at low engine speeds, even if they behave very differently at peak HP. You're not driving at peak HP all the time, so for street driving I find the displacement/weight measurement very useful.

 

So that's why I ask about the mini. The Z will weigh around 2200-2400 pounds, and 2.8 liter is more than 1 liter per 1,000 pounds, which is better than many muscle cars.

Just to be clear, the diff won't affect where in the rev range the engine makes the most power. You want to match the characteristics of the cam with the driveline. I still see you saying you want good low end torque, but also want to wind it out and make good power at high revs too. On our L28s, you have to compromise - the better the engine makes power at high revs, the weaker its torque will be at low revs.

 

That said, I run a 4.11 diff with an 81-83 zx 5 speed and find the combination a lot of fun to drive on the street. The 4.11 means that I don't have to downshift as often as with a lower diff, and I can wind it out in 2nd gear without hitting go to jail speeds. It also spends very little time in the lower rpm range as long as I'm willing to shift. When I ran NA on the track it was great because there was always a gear where I was in the power band i.e. above 3500 rpm.

 

This site is a great way to get an idea of where your shift points will be with various combinations. You might compare to your Mini to get a frame of reference.

 

As for whether you should get an LSD, for a street driven Z I'd vote no. The LSD adds weight, cost, and makes the car push when under power, and then loosens when it unlocks from lifting the throttle. I was surprised how much of a difference it made in sweeping turns on the street. Note: this is with a CLSD. A VLSD might be less intrusive. Unless you really stiffen the rear suspension, you will probably find that you don't need it.

I gotta disagree on the LSD. The traction difference coming out of corners is way more important than understeer on a street car, and if you're carving canyons and that sort of thing, you can tune around it with suspension.

 

A 2 way LSD, like the Nissan CLSD, limits slip under power and decel, and has spring preload when feathering the throttle, the amount of lockup changes as a function of the torque sent to it, but it doesn't unlock under decel.
